Wolf Alice announce new EP 'Blue Lullaby'

Following up the enormous praise for their recently released studio album 'Blue Weekend', Wolf Alice have now announced an accompanying EP, arriving next month.

The new four-track collection 'Blue Lullaby' will feature stripped-back renditions of songs featured on their latest full-length, is being previewed by the new version of 'The Last Man On Earth', and is set to be released on the 24th June via Dirty Hit.

Speaking about the new EP, frontwoman Ellie Rowsell said, “Blue Lullaby came about because we wanted to strip down some of our more emotional songs from Blue Weekend and see if they hit any different. We also had a really nice moment during the Blue Weekend campaign singing one of our songs with a choir and we wanted to experience that again with a few other songs, especially as there are a lot of harmonies and a lot of vocal layering on Blue Weekend. Hearing multiple voices singing together is an unparalleled feeling to me so I'm happy we got to record this experience and I hope people enjoy it.”

'Blue Lullaby' Tracklist:
1.“No Hard Feelings” (Lullaby Version)
2.“Lipstick On The Glass” (Lullaby Version)
3.“How Can I Make it ok?” (Lullaby Version)
4.“The Last Man On Earth” (Lullaby Version)
